Chicago 2017 is now firmly in the rear-view mirror, O’Hare Airport and all.
The show itself was a well attended event, with a just announced attendance of nearly seven thousand paid. According to show organizers, this was a 13% increase over 2016. From my standpoint, AXPONA 2017 was a busy show, with good to great traffic on all three days. In fact, the Westin O’Hare Hotel was so packed that parking really was an issue. Many people had to park elsewhere and walk or shuttle in. Even the Westin shuttle bus to the airport was having trouble making it around the parking loop.
Regardless, the AXPONA team and Liz Miller did a very fine job of making this year’s show run smoothly, without any major hassles that I am aware of. My hat’s off to them for making the experience a pleasant one for all attendees. A large audio show is a huge enterprise; to do it this well is a tribute to a job well done.
